Henry Whipple, Salem, Massachusetts, 1836-01-01. Hardcover. Acceptable. 0x0x0. (1836; Bookstore of Henry Whipple) No Map. Very delicate. 12mo. Original dark green blind stamped boards with leather at spine. Gold gilt lettering barely visible. Upper corner appears chewed (?), Leather very worn. Bumped and fraying at all corners. Extensive foxing to pages, but unmarked and legible. Binding and hinges intact with no separations. Wonderful historical data on Essex County Massachusetts. With historical sketches of each town and data on population, officials , religious societies, schools, military etc. No Maps
